Ditch the workout and join the party! The Town of Florence Parks and Recreation Department is now offering Zumba Fitness.  Achieve long-term benefits while experiencing an exciting dance party atmosphere full of Latin and international music. 

You’ll forget you’re working out with the exotic, but easy to follow dance moves.  You work out to music such as salsa, cha-cha, raggeton, mambo and merengue. The result of this fusion is a fun, energetic workout that feels more like a night out dancing than a workout in your health club. 

The classes are held on Tuesday evenings in October from 6:30 pm to 7:30 pm at the Florence High School Dance Room, located at 1000 S. Main Street.  The classes are open to anyone 16 years of age and older. 

The fee is $20 per session and the registration deadline is Saturday, October 4th.   You must pre-register for this class at the Florence Fitness Center, located at 133 N. Main Street, or online.
